首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SQL并排获取两列,一个多值,一个唯一值

,可以使用JOIN或UNION操作实现。

  1. 使用JOIN操作:
    • 将两个表按照某个条件进行连接,得到多值和唯一值所在的列。
    • 语法:SELECT table1.column1, table2.column2 FROM table1 JOIN table2 ON table1.columnX = table2.columnY;
    • 示例:假设有两个表students和grades,students表包含学生的姓名和学号,grades表包含学生的学号和成绩。要获取学生的姓名和对应的成绩,可以使用以下SQL语句:
    • 示例:假设有两个表students和grades,students表包含学生的姓名和学号,grades表包含学生的学号和成绩。要获取学生的姓名和对应的成绩,可以使用以下SQL语句:
    • 推荐的腾讯云相关产品:腾讯云云数据库 MySQL版,详情请参考腾讯云云数据库 MySQL版
  • 使用UNION操作:
    • 将两个查询结果按行合并,并且去除重复值。
    • 语法:SELECT column1 FROM table1 UNION SELECT column2 FROM table2;
    • 示例:假设有两个表fruits和vegetables,fruits表包含水果的名称,vegetables表包含蔬菜的名称。要获取水果和蔬菜的名称,可以使用以下SQL语句:
    • 示例:假设有两个表fruits和vegetables,fruits表包含水果的名称,vegetables表包含蔬菜的名称。要获取水果和蔬菜的名称,可以使用以下SQL语句:
    • 推荐的腾讯云相关产品:腾讯云CDN加速,详情请参考腾讯云CDN加速

以上是关于SQL并排获取两列,一个多值,一个唯一值的答案。如有其他问题或需要进一步了解,请提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券